Pink Punch
1 large tub of soft vanilla ice cream
1 2-liter of strawberry soda
1 package frozen crushed strawberries
Allow strawberries to thaw and ice cream to soften. Add most of the ice cream. Next add the strawberries and strawberry soda then stir. Add more ice cream to the top.

This is great salad and easy to make.
1 pkg rasberry or strawberry Jello
1 10 0z container Cool Whip
1 pkg Minature marshmellows
1 12oz can crushed pineapple well drained
1/2 cup chopped walnuts or pecans

Mix Jello mix w/ rest of ingredients and chill for 2 to 3 hrs
very good and refreshing

Pink Lady
6 ounces Piña Colada mix (no alcohol)
6 maraschino cherries
3 ounces orange juice or Sunny Delight
1 1/2 cups ice
In a blender, combine ice, Piña Colada mix, 4 maraschino cherries, and orange juice. Blend until smooth. Pour into two glasses, serve with maraschino cherry as garnish. *Also great with fresh strawberries, pineapples, pineapple juice, or oranges.*

I know of this really yummy fruit dip. Real simple

1 pkg of Cream Cheese softened
1 container of Raspberry Fluff

just mix together, it will come up pink from the fluff, can also use regular white fluff if no color theme, serve with different types of sliced fruit.
